Find the probability of the given event.
A bag contains 5 red marbles, 3 blue marbles, and 1 green marble. A randomly drawn marble is not blue.
a. 3/2
b. 6
c. 1/3
d. 2/3

In this case, you have a total of 5%2B3%2B1=9 marbles.
The odds of drawing a blue marble are 3%2F9 = 1%2F3
So the odds of drawing a 'non-blue marble is 1+-+%281%2F3%29 = 2%2F3
